Kodak Blacks Legal Team Blasts Cops Over Son’s Treatment During Raid

(AllHipHop News) Kodak Black and his legal team have their sights trained on several police officers with the Broward County Sheriff’s, over the way they treated the rapper’s two-year-old son.

Kodak’s house was raided on January 18th, by the Broward County Gang Unit.

The raid was prompted by an Instagram video Kodak posted five days earlier, where the two-year-old child was shown to be in the presence of marijuana smoke and guns.

When the cops raided his house later in the week, Kodak claims they ransacked his house and left the two-year-old child outside in the cold in just a diaper.

Kodak’s lawyer told TheBlast that cops left the two-year-old “on the porch in a diaper and T-shirt staring at his father while he was in handcuffs, and did not get pants or shoes until Kodak’s legal team showed up and demanded the child be taken care of.”

Kodak’s lawyer has deposed three of the officers who took part in the raid, which was supposed to be a simple probation check.

The three officers are scheduled to be deposed on February 8th.

Kodak Black remains behind bars until his next hearing on February 23rd

Kodak is facing seven felony counts in connection with the raid, which turned up a small amount of marijuana and a stolen handgun.

Nelly Files Countersuit Against Rape Accuser

(AllHipHop News) Nelly is firing back at his rape accuser, in a counter-lawsuit.

The Saint Louis rapper is making good on his promise to sue Monique Greene for what he claims are false allegations.

Monique Greene has claimed that Nelly raped her on his tour bus, after a stop in Washington, last October.

Nelly’s lawsuit claims Monique Greene made her way into the VIP section, where she flirted with the rapper.

Nelly admitted to having sex with the woman, although he claims it was consensual and police never pressed charges against him.

According to the lawsuit, the woman became upset when one of Nelly’s backup dancers barged into an area on the bus, where they were having sex.

Nelly’s lawsuit claims Monique Greene’s public allegations have damaged his public image, and also caused him to lose business and bookings.

50 Cent Slashing Price Of Connecticut Mansion By Half

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=7VKIIa42Yko

(AllHipHop News) Hip-Hop star 50 Cent has cut the price of his massive Connecticut mansion by half in a bid to offload the property, a decade after it was first listed.

The “In Da Club” hitmaker purchased the 52-room Farmington estate for $4.1 million from boxer Mike Tyson in 2003 and poured millions into renovations.

He then placed it on the market for $18.5 million in 2007 but took down the listing when it failed to attract a buyer, only to try again in 2015 following his bankruptcy filing.

50, real name Curtis Jackson, has now hired a new realtor to drum up some interest, recruiting “Million Dollar Listing” New York reality star and Douglas Elliman representative Fredrik Eklund, who has put the home up for sale for just under $5 million.

The lavish house boasts 19 bedrooms, 25 bathrooms, an indoor pool with a hot tub, as well as its own nightclub, a full gym, a home theater, a recording studio, and a basketball court.

The news emerges eight months after a man was arrested for breaking into the property last May.

50 Cent, who was not at the sprawling pad at the time, joked about the incident on social media, quipping, “What my house got robbed, I thought I sold that MF (motherf##ker).”

He was previously said to have found a buyer for the one-time party palace in March 2016 for $8.5 million, after the interested party expressed plans to turn it into an assisted living facility.

But his representative subsequently clarified the claims, admitting that although there had been discussions, no contracts had been signed and the home remained for sale.

Clerk Of Court Slipped Letter To Meek Begging For Money During Hearing

(AllHipHop News) An exclusive letter has been released, showing that the clerk of the court which sentenced Meek to 2 to 4 years in prison, asked the rap star for money.

Wanda Chavarria slipped a letter addressed to “Mr. Williams” asking him to pay her son’s college tuition.

Chavarria admitted she passed the note to Meek during his probation hearing in November, asking to fork over the money at Virginia Commonwealth University.

“This will probably be my son’s last semester at VCU if the tuition isn’t paid for this year and unfortunately with my bad credit, I am unable to secure a loan or cosign a loan for my son,” the note obtained by TMZ.com reads. “Anything you can do is very much appreciated. Every little helps — please donate what you can to keep him attending VCU.”

Meek Mill refused to fork over any money and Chavarria’s son is planning to graduate in May.

The letter adds to a list of odd requests made of Meek Mill from the court which oversaw his probation from a 2008 gun and drug arrest.

Meek Mill and his lawyers have insisted Judge Genece Brinkley asked him to rerecord a Boyz II Men tribute song in her honor, in addition to asking her to drop Roc Nation as his management.The rap star’s 2-to 4-year incarceration for a series us of minor infractions has sparked a nationwide debate on the criminal justice system.

Artists, politicians and activists including T.I., Jay-Z, Rev. Al Sharpton and Colin Kaepernick have offered words of support for Meek, who is serving his time at State Correctional Facility in Chester, Pennsylvania.

Obie Trice Sues After Getting Beaten & Maced By Crazed Security Guard

(AllHipHop News) Detroit rapper Obie Trice is heading to court, alleging that he was beaten up by a security guard at a hotel.

Obie filed a lawsuit against a Marriott in Detroit, alleging security guards with G4S Security attacked him because they did not believe he was staying in the hotel.

The incident began in April of 2016 at the Renaissance Center, when Obie was checking into the Marriott with a female companion.

She went to use the restroom, and when Obie, who had not booked a room yet, went to the concierge to check prices G4S Security guards followed him and a confrontation ensued.

Obie claims he was brutally attacked by the hotel’s security and was battered and maced in the fight.

“To make matters worse, while plaintiff was handcuffed, defendants choked plaintiff by pouring water all over his nose and mouth,” the lawsuit asserts.

Obie Trice is suing the Marriott and G4S Security for negligent hiring, negligent infliction of emotional distress, false arrest and false imprisonment.

The rapper is seeking no less than $25,000 in damages.

Suge Knight’s Lawyers Sent To Jail For Trying To Bribe Witnesses

(AllHipHop News) Two of Marion “Suge” Knight’s lawyers have been arrested in Los Angeles in connection with the former mogul’s upcoming murder trial.

The lawyers, Matthew Fletcher and Thaddeus Culpepper, were detained yesterday (January 25) by Los Angeles cops.

Police accused Matthew Fletcher of being in a conspiracy with Suge to obtain fabricated statements for his upcoming murder trial.

Suge is accused of using his Ford F-150 Raptor truck to injure Cle “Bone” Sloan and to kill Terry Carter after a confrontation that happened at a burger joint in Los Angeles during a taping for a commercial for the movie “Straight Outta Compton’ in January of 2015.

Investigators say they have transcripts of Suge and Fletcher working together to pay as much as $25,000 to bikers for phony testimony, to affirm the victims were armed in the deadly encounter with Suge.

“If we can get the two or three versions from the bikers on tape and we can get, we’re done,” Matthew Fletcher said. “It’s going home time. Right? That’s a fair … investment, you know, 20, 25 thousand dollars.”

Suge’s other lawyer, Thaddeus Culpepper was also arrested last night (January 25).

Authorities insist Thaddeus Culpepper tried to work with a source who turned out to be a sheriff’s department informant.

Culpepper reportedly also offered to pay for eyewitness testimony, which would reflect positively on Suge.

Matthew Fletcher is currently locked up on $1,000,000 bail while information about Thaddeus Culpepper’s bail condition is not known.

Over the past several months, several of Suge’s associates have been arrested, jailed or subpoenaed for tampering with the case.

In October of 2017, Suge’s ex-girlfriend Toi-Lin Kelly pleaded no contest to conspiracy to violate a court order and was sentenced to 100 hours of community service, for leaking a video to TMZ.com for $55,000, allegedly, with Fletcher’s help.

Earlier this week, two producers associated with the docu-series “Death Row Chronicles” were issued subpoenas by a grand jury, for interviewing Suge while he is in jail.

A judge has barred Suge from having any contact with anyone except a single attorney.

The former Death Row Records CEO has constantly complained about his jail conditions since he was locked up in January of 2015.

Suge Knight’s trial for murder is supposed to start on February 22.
